    To Analyze the Clinical Background of the Infertility and its Pathological Correlation in Endometrium Cases

    Abstract

    The aim of the study is to analyze the clinical background of the infertility and its pathological correlation in endometrium cases. The criteria for primary and secondary infertility were decided failed to conceive within one or more years of continuous marital life without the use of any contraceptive measure were considered to be cases of primary infertility while the cases in whom one or more pregnancies are followed by one or more years of involuntary barreneness were regarded as cases of secondary infertility. Results: Most common presenting complaints were that of barrenness alone in both primary and secondary infertility cases. Infertility with menstrual disturbances was that the next common complaint. Relative frequency of complaint in primary and secondary infertility in 50 cases observed. The study is based on one cycle one biopsy basis. Endometrial curettage or biopsy was reported as a premenstrual procedure in all the cases. Conclusion: Consciousness among people increasing day by day as the commonest complaint of both primary and secondary infertility was that of barrenness, in contrast to others who found menstrual disturbances as predominate complaint. Anovulatory cycle was the most common and important etiological factor of female infertility. Thus present study confirms that endometrial study is a marvelous help to the clinician and infertile women
